What are some common materials used in structural design?

Structural design is a crucial aspect of civil engineering that involves the analysis and design of structures such as buildings, bridges, and tunnels. The materials used in structural design must be strong, durable, and able to withstand the forces and loads that the structure will be subjected to. In this article, we will explore some of the most common materials used in structural design.

Concrete:

Concrete is one of the most commonly used materials in structural design due to its strength, durability, and versatility. It is made by mixing cement, water, and aggregates such as sand, gravel, or crushed stone. Concrete can be cast into any shape and size, making it ideal for use in a wide range of structures such as buildings, bridges, and dams.

Steel:

Steel is another popular material used in structural design. It is known for its strength, durability, and resistance to corrosion. Steel is often used in the construction of high-rise buildings, bridges, and other structures that require high strength and durability. It is also used in the construction of industrial buildings and warehouses due to its ability to withstand heavy loads.

Wood:

Wood is a renewable resource that is often used in structural design. It is lightweight, easy to work with, and has good insulation properties. Wood is often used in the construction of residential buildings, bridges, and other structures. However, wood is not as strong as concrete or steel and is susceptible to rot and decay if not treated properly.

Masonry:

Masonry is a building material made from bricks, concrete blocks, or stone. It is often used in the construction of walls, arches, and other structures. Masonry structures are known for their strength and durability, and they can withstand high winds and earthquakes. However, masonry structures are heavy and require a strong foundation to support their weight.

Glass:

Glass is a versatile material that can be used in structural design. It is often used in the construction of buildings, bridges, and other structures due to its transparency and aesthetic appeal. Glass structures can be used to create unique and visually stunning designs. However, glass is not as strong as concrete or steel and is susceptible to breakage if not treated properly.

In conclusion, the materials used in structural design must be strong, durable, and able to withstand the forces and loads that the structure will be subjected to. Concrete, steel, wood, masonry, and glass are some of the most common materials used in structural design. Each material has its own unique properties and advantages, and the choice of material depends on the specific requirements of the structure.
